By her own admission she was given first dibs on a condo unit before it went on sale to the general public because she was part of some special "insider" club (I believe that was the term used).

Now people will say "big deal" - this is how all condos are sold - the first buyers are always given a special deal as risk-takers but lets remember One Cole was unlike any other condo project in that the building was close to completion before it ever went on sale. There was no upfront risk for the buyers!

It was thanks to a deal with the city that the developer was able to build the condo tower before putting the units on sale (normally 60% of a project must be sold before a shovel goes in the ground).

It was a unique and very special opportunity therefore for the select group of "insiders" who were given first shot - and lo and behold look who wound up with one of the most coveted units in the building - the local Councillor who pushed for and voted in favor of the special arrangement between the developer and the city!

The integrity commissioner investigated and found no wrongdoing. There is no allegation that what took place was illegal but I think it stinks still the same!
